The Surveying laboratory enables the students to understand and practice the basic principles of surveying by conducting field exercises using a wide spectrum of surveying equipment ranging from traditional dumpy levels, tilting level, compass, transits, plane table and theodolites to the latest electronic auto level, digital theodolite, Total station and GPS. This laboratory covers data collection methods including surveying, profile leveling, contouring,compass traversing, laying out of curves, base line measurement and triangulation. |

STRENGTH OF MATERIALS LAB
This laboratory deals with the testing of materials for their strength and stiffness. Building materials such as steel, timber are tested to know their response under applied loads with respect to strength, stiffness, deflection and bending. Student will be exposed to testing of materials and interpretation of test results in terms of material suitability to the intended consruction. Geo-Technical Lab
Soil Testing is an integral part of soil mechanics and foundation engineering. Geotechnical laboratory consists of various equipment to test the soil. In this laboratory the student will be exposed to testing of soil and interpretation towards identification and suitability of soil to different intended construction projects. All physical and engineering properties of soils will be assessed in the laboratory. |

Concrete & Highway Material Testing Lab
The testing and inspection of concrete and concrete aggregates are important elements in obtaining quality construction. The laboratory allows the students to test and assess the various fresh and hardened concrete properties that may affect the performance of concrete members. There are many apparatus and machines available at the concrete technology laboratory like Sieve Shaker, Compression Testing Machine (CTM), Flexure Testing Machine (FTM), Compaction Factor Apparatus, Heat of Hydration apparatus, Permeability apparatus etc. |

Environmental Engineering Lab
The Environmental Engineering laboratory practicals provide good insight into different experimental methods relevant to Environmental Engineering. In this laboratory, the students performs various tests on water and sewage samples to check their pH value, Total dissolved solids (TDS), BOD, COD, Total suspended particles etc. Testing of samples helps to assess the water quality standard of the region, pollution load in sewage and working efficiency of sewage and other water treatment units. |

Engineering Geology Lab
The identification of different types of rocks, minerals and understanding their behavior are the major objectives of geology. Further, development of cracks, fissures in rocks, their causes and their remedies are to be learnt in this laboratory. |

Fluid Mechanics and Hydraulic Machines
A basic knowledge of Fluid mechanics and hydraulic machinery is essential for all the scientists and engineers because they frequently come across a variety of problems involving flow of fluids such as in aerodynamics, force of fluid on structural surfaces, fluid transport. This fluid mechanics laboratory helps to understand these physical processes more closely. Various apparatus are available in the laboratory like, Verification of Bernoulli's theorem apparatus, venturi & Orifice meters, orifice & mouth piece apparatus, Flow over notches apparatus, vortex flow apparatus etc. |
